Captain Flint And Billy Bones in Flint: Treasure Of Oblivion

In Robert Louis Stevenson’s novel, “Treasure Island” published in 1881, Captain Flint is merely mentioned and doesn’t physically appear. This contrasts with some movie adaptations where he does show up. Nevertheless, Captain Flint plays a significant role as the pirate who buried the famous treasure and passed its location to Billy Bones. In response to why the studio made Captain Flint the main character in “Flint: Treasure of Oblivion,” Josse stated that they aimed for a timeless pirate figure whose story would resonate with a broad audience. They cited “Treasure Island” as one of their thematic cornerstones.

Absolutely, Captain Flint may be a fictional character, but he is greatly admired in the world of pirates, even extending beyond Robert Louis Stevenson’s novel. By selecting Flint and Bones, the team was able to delve into potential events and backstories that occurred prior to the adventures depicted in “Treasure Island”.

Instead of retelling the story as it unfolds in ‘Treasure Island’, we decided to explore an imagined prequel, shedding more light on the enigmatic character of Flint, who, though not the main protagonist, is portrayed as a legendary figure within the novel.

In contrast to other adaptations of Treasure Island, such as Disney’s futuristic sci-fi movie Treasure Planet, Flint: Treasure of Oblivion is not meant to follow the established storyline of Treasure Island. Instead, it offers a fresh perspective on what the characters’ pasts could have been according to the studio’s vision. This innovative concept has the potential to draw in fans of both Treasure Island and pirate tales alike.

In addition, Josse pointed out that players have the freedom to delve into unearthed locales in search of treasure and concealed artifacts, and they may opt to adhere to or deviate from the main narrative. Furthermore, Josse characterized Flint: Treasure of Oblivion as an authentic pirate expedition that emphasizes realism in its storytelling.

As a swashbuckling gamer, I can tell you that “Flint: Treasure of Oblivion” is more than just a pirate simulator; it’s an immersive yarn spun with the flair of a sea shanty, a tale woven from the rich tapestry of piracy lore as it might have been passed down through generations.

Speaking of it, the tale of Flint: Treasure of Oblivion also incorporates elements of the supernatural, which Savage Level is keeping secret as an exciting mystery for players to uncover. Although pirate stories often delve into supernatural elements, these could significantly amplify the already captivating storyline, given its portrayal of piracy and potential events preceding the adventures depicted in Treasure Island. Of course, fans will have to stay tuned for the game’s release in October to witness how Captain Flint’s story unfolds.

The highly-anticipated game titled “Flint: Treasure of Oblivion” is set to be launched on October 24, 2024, available for play on P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X/S.
